Архив

Архив рубрики ‘OS’

Родительский контроль – доступ к сайтам

Отключим доступ к одноклассникам!

Предположим Вы добрый родитель и решили отключить доступ к одноклассникам для своего чада. Может Вы злой преподаватель и Вас достало то что ученики сидят в социальных сетях.

Как быстро без специального программного обеспечения отключить доступ к определенным сайтам, доменам….

Читать далее…

Рубрики:Секреты, Linux, Mobiles

Установка Qt в fedora – Qt install on fedora

для начала можно обозреть что же есть вообще в репозиториях

из под root в консоле набиваем:

yum list qt*

видим qt-devel

и продолжаем

yum install qt-devel

Но асистен в набор не входит.. правим эту неприятность

yum install qt-assistant

так как QtCreator’a в репозиториях нет можно воспользоваться Qdevelop

yum install qdevelopи

и бонусом к нему желательно

yum install ctags

Все! Программируйте господа на здоровье!

Рубрики:Программируем, Linux Метки:

Fedora установка драйверов ATI Catalyst (fglrx) Drivers Install

Шаг 1: Обновить kernel

[root@fedora ~]$ yum update kernel

[root@fedora ~]$ yum install kernel-devel

Шаг 2: Скачать драйвер

Скачать

Шаг 3: Установить драйвер

Устанавливаем драйвер с помощью командной строки

[root@fedora ~]$ bash ./ati-driver-installer-9-8-x86.x86_64.run

Шаг 4: Проверим результат установки

Проверьте /usr/share/ati/fglrx-install.log файл результат установки. Если нет ошибок, переходите к следующему шагу.

Шаг 5: Создаем файл конфигурации

[root@fedora ~]$ aticonfig –initial

Шаг 6: Перезагрузка

[root@fedora ~]$ reboot

Рубрики:Linux, OS

Линукс для программистов – выбор очевиден!

Нам нужно выбрать линукс, дистрибутив в котором Вы хотите программировать!  И это хорошо!

Поехали..

Так как Вы задаете себе вопрос “какой-же Линукс лучше подойдет для программирования?” – значит вы слишком плохо знаете Линукс либо решили что в мире что-то произошло сверх глобальное и вы об этом не узнали(русские купили микрософт).  Осмелюсь предположить что Вы еще начинающий программист…

Теперь начнем разбирать что же такое Линукс!

Линукс – название для Unix подобных операционных систем на основе одноимённого ядра, одинаковых библиотек и системных программ которые распространяются под лицензией GNU (бесплатно делай что хочешь). Выходит Linux младший брат Unix но очень популярный… софт и ядро у всех Линуксов одно и тоже.

Выходит разницы и нет, линукс взять можно любой. На фаршируем наш линукс последним софтом и программируй на здоровье!

1. Нас должно устраивать в выбранном нами дистрибутиве это максимально большой список программ в репозиториях.

Репозитории – это место где лежат(хранятся в интернете) уже готовые (скомпилированные и не только) программы просто установка в два клика и они уже установлены и работают! Для начинающего программиста это важно. Для ленивого и опытного важно не меньше :)

2. Выбор цацок. Цацки – это жаргонный термин который я использую для охарактеризации таких мелочей как удобная среда рабочего стола, их выбор велик как по мне GNOME 3 очень даже ничего себе(хороший значит). К цакам относится выбор IDE и т д. Но цацки перестают быть цацками если у тебя совсем дохлый комп. В этом случае выбирай то что работает быстрее так как например для среды рабочего стола подойдет Xfce она потребляет (жрет) меньше ресурсов.

уСе

Кен Томпсон и Денис Ритчи — создатели UNIX

Кен Томпсон и Денис Ритчи — создатели UNIX

А ты готов стать таким?

 
 
 
 
 
 
 
 
 
 
 
 
Зачем ответил.. вопрос риторический.

Данная статья написана типа в общих назидательных целях и не претендует на шедевр Да Винчи. Цель объяснить:  программистам пофиг какой у них дистрибутив, они программисты.

QtStalker & Fedora сборка и запуск

Линукс тем и замечательный что для установки простой программы нам понадобится знания программирования, консольных команд, правка исходного кода, решение проблем с загрузкой динамических библиотек и прочие нюансы по настройке системы.

Все это делает Линукс уникальным продуктом в который если при желании установить программу не получается то куда там вирусам братьям нашим меньшим.

И так QtStalker

Программа для анализа и обзора котировок.

В данной статье кратко описываю подводные камни при попытке собрать и запустить QtStalker.

необходимые пакеты

qt3-devel

ta-lib

Berkeley DB >= 4.1

все это есть в стандартных репозиториях.

Править файлы:

/src/IndicatorPage.cpp

/lib/UpgradeMessage.cpp

вставить

#include <stdlib.h>

или

#include <cstdlib>

из под root создаем ярлыки на ta-lib H файлы

у меня это выглядит так

ln -s ‘/usr/include/ta-lib/ta_abstract.h’ ‘/usr/include/ta-lib/ta_common.h’ ‘/usr/include/ta-lib/ta_defs.h’ ‘/usr/include/ta-lib/ta_func.h’ ‘/usr/include/ta-lib/ta_libc.h’ ‘/usr/include’
далее все как обычно ./configure и make

и если все собралось в папке /qtstalker/src/ есть бинарник qtstalker он конечно не запускается

ошибка примерно такая

/usr/local/bin/qtstalker: error while loading shared libraries: libqtstalker.so.0: cannot open shared object file: No such file or directory

для исправления этой неприятности добавляем путь к нашим библиотекам (у меня строка примерно такая ‘/home/x-man/project/qtstalker/lib/’) в файл /etc/ld.so.conf и в консоле запускаем ldconfig -v (из под root).

Все! Теперь должно работать. Как отобразить в QtStalker хоть что-то – опишу в другой статье.

PS
команда для создания ярлыков 
ln -s [TARGET DIRECTORY OR FILE] ./[SHORTCUT]
Образец:  

ln -s /usr/local/apache/logs ./logs
Из под root запустить gedit
># su -lc gedit

Fedora 15 установить кодеки

Fedora 13, 14, 15 установка кодеков:

Так как кодеки дело коммерческое, то по умолчанию их просто нет в Fedora.

И так начнем с кодеков для просмотра видео. Самый простой способ это – установить VCL player он установится в месте с кодеками. Но смотреть придется только через него.

Способ №1

И так в консоле набираем команды по очереди и на все вопросы отвечаем утвердительно (Y).

 $> su -
 #> rpm -ivh http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m
 #> yum install vlc

Первая команда(su) для того чтоб делать все от имени root(Администратор) надо знать пароль
Вторая команда добавляет репозиторий для загрузки.
Третья команда выполняет установку VCL.

Способ №2

Опять командная строка, скопируйте и вставте комнду целиком

su -c ‘yum localinstall –nogpgcheck http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-stable.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-stable.noarch.rpm’

Введите пароль root на все вопросы отвечаем утвердительно (y). И так репозиторий добавлен. Осталось воспользоваться им!

Опять: su

 $> su
 #> yum install gstreamer-plugins-ugly
 #> yum install gstreamer-plugins-bad
 #> yum install gstreamer-ffmpeg

Ну вот, теперь стандартный плеер будет воспроизводить большентсво видео файлов.
Рекомендую воспользоваться двумя способами.

Возможность воспроизведения Mp3 появляется автоматически после установки видео кодеков.

Рубрики:Install, Linux, Multimedia, OS Метки: ,

Как настроить запрос на прерывание (IRQ) приоритеты в Windows Vista и 7

Большинство компонентов, непосредственно связанными с вашей материнской платой, в том числе PCI слоты, IDE контроллеры, последовательные порты, порт для подключения клавиатуры, и даже CMOS вашей материнской платы, имеют индивидуальные запросы прерываний (IRQ), возложенные на них.

Прерывание запроса или IRQ, определяется номером  аппаратной линии, над которым устройство может прервать поток данных в процессоре, что позволяет устройству работать.

И так начнем с открытия утилиты System Information (msinfo32.exe)

На этой вкладке видно какие устройства под каким номером.

Далее, откройте редактор реестра и перейдите к

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\PriorityControl

Создайте новый параметр типа DWORD , и назовите его IRQ13Priority, где
13 является номером IRQ  устройства которому вы хотите задать приоритет (например, для IRQ13Priority – IRQ 13, наш цифровой процессор).

Дважды щелкните на новое значение, и ввести номер его приоритет 1. Введите 1 для приоритетной задачей, 2 для второй, и так далее. Убедитесь в том, чтобы не вводить  то же число приоритета для двух записей, и сохранить его.  Экспериментируйте устанавливая значения 1 и 2.

Закройте редактор реестра и перезагрузите компьютер, когда вы закончите.

Некоторые получили хорошие результаты увеличив приоритет для IRQ 8 (система ).

 

И как вы уже догадались: ВСЕ ДЕЛАЕТЕ НА СВОЙ СТРАХ И РИСК АВТОР СТАТЬИ НЕ НЕСЕТ НИКАКОЙ ОТВЕТСТВЕННОСТИ

Рубрики:Секреты, OS Метки: ,

Interrupts – процесс грузит процессор.

“Hardware Interrupts”- Прерыв аппаратных средств.

Что может быть и как лечить:

  1. Вирус.
  2. Надо включить винт или привод в режим DMA.
  3. Перегрев северного моста.(Либо нужно ставить новый кулер на него, либо – если уже поздно – готовить бабло на новую матерь.)
  4. Если это WinXP SP2 и проц AMD64 или один из новых Pentium с поддержкой NX-бита, то, возможно, глючит аппаратная защита данных (DEP или PAE).
  5. Ситуацию могут спровоцировать TV-тюнеры, принтеры HP, адаптеры беспроводных сетей или просто 2 PCI-карточки, воткнутые в 1 и 5 pci-слоты…
  6. Хард твой потихонечку дохнет :(
  7. Заменить шлейф на 80 пин.
  8. Поменять местами шлейфы в материнке.
  9. Процессор находится в режиме PAE. Запретить PAE и DEP
    В файле boot.ini дописать /noexecute=AlwaysOff . Если там имеется /noexecute=OptIn -удалить.
  10. Если винт/привод переходит в режим PIO то возможно что то с его питанием.(отключить лишние устройства, дополнительные винты, приводы, тюнеры, кулеры, сменить блок питания)
  11. Некоторым помогает KB896256 ОС Windows XP
  12. Переустановить драйвера на чипсет.
  13. Проблемы бывают еще с неисправными видео картами.
  14. Отключить диспетчер логических дисков в службах XP.
  15. Заходим в “Панель управления\Администрирование\Просмотр Событий” – ищем ответы там…
  16. 1. Заходим в диспетчер устройств.
    2. Выбираем Вид->Устройства по типу
    3. Разворачиваем “Запрос на прерывание IRQ” и смотрим какие устройства относятся одному и тому же каналу IRQ. Пробуем отключить одно из этих устройств и посмотреть загруженность проца.
  17. В биосе отключить  USB 2.0 и всякие full speed для него.

ВСЕ ДЕЛАЕТЕ НА СВОЙ СТРАХ И РИСК

Аппаратное прерывание – это реакция процессора на события, происходящие асинхронно по отношению к исполняемому программному коду. То есть прерывание – это момент когда центральный процессор по запросу от вызвавшего прерывание устройства откладывает выполняемую задачу и переключается на задачу, необходимую для работы устройства. После того, как задача для устройства выполнена, процессор вновь переключается на выполнение основной программы. Далее.

Рубрики:Вирусы, Секреты, OS Метки: ,
Follow

Get every new post delivered to your Inbox.